For debatable reasoning: Which term describes enamel at the base of pits and fissures becoming porous from mineral loss?

Explanation:
The main idea is recognizing how mineral loss creates porosity in enamel during early caries, especially at the base of pits and fissures. When enamel demineralizes, minerals are removed from the crystal structure, forming voids that increase porosity. This measurable increase in pore volume at the base of pits and fissures is described as the quantitative porous zone. It captures the idea of active mineral loss producing a porous, subsurface change. Other terms don’t fit this specific caries-related porosity: an etched zone refers to a surface layer created by acid etching for bonding, not a natural caries lesion; pellicle is just the salivary film on enamel; and a cavitation zone denotes actual cavity formation, which is a more advanced stage than the initial porous change at the base of pits.
